What is Local Glass Repair?


Local glass repair refers to the services provided by organizations that concentrate on fixing and replacing glass in numerous applications, such as vehicle, residential, and commercial settings. This can include window panes, windshields, mirrors, glass doors, and more. Local glass repair services can conserve you time, money, and tension by addressing glass-related problems promptly.

Why is Local Glass Repair Important?

Local glass repair is essential for several reasons:

  1. Safety: Cracked or broken glass can present severe security risks. Prompt repairs assist remove threats.
  2. Energy Efficiency: Damaged windows can cause energy loss, leading to higher utility costs. Fixing or replacing glass assists maintain a comfy environment.
  3. Visual Appeal: Broken glass can diminish the total appearance of a home or car. Repairs help restore looks.
  4. Increased Property Value: Well-maintained glass features can enhance the worth of a home, making it more appealing to prospective purchasers.

How to Choose a Local Glass Repair Service


Selecting the ideal local glass repair service can make all the distinction in the quality of work and customer complete satisfaction. Here are essential elements to consider:

Tips for Selecting a Glass Repair Provider

  1. Reputation: Check online reviews and request suggestions from family and friends. A great credibility frequently shows quality service.

  2. Experience: Look for companies that have been in the market for several years and have a tested track record.

  3. Accreditations: Verify if the technicians are licensed or trained in glass repair and setup. Certifications show professionalism and proficiency.

  4. Warranty: Inquire about service warranties on repairs and installations. A trusted company will stand behind its work.

  5. Insurance: Ensure the company is insured. This will safeguard you from liability in case of accidents during the repair procedure.

  6. Free Estimates: Request several quotes to compare costs and services. A transparent rates structure is a great sign.

  7. Accessibility: Opt for a service that provides same-day or emergency repairs, specifically for crucial issues like a broken windscreen.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. How long does it take to repair a broken windscreen?

The time it requires to repair a windscreen can vary, however generally, minor chips can be repaired in 30-60 minutes. If the damage is extensive, a complete replacement might be required, which can take numerous hours.

2. Are repairs covered by insurance coverage?

Numerous insurance coverage cover glass repair, especially for windscreens. Talk to your insurance coverage service provider to comprehend your coverage alternatives.

3. Can I drive my automobile with a chipped windshield?

While little chips might not block your view, it's recommended to get them repaired as soon as possible. Driving with a harmed windshield can be prohibited in some areas and might jeopardize your safety.

4. What can I do to maintain my windows after repair?

Regular cleaning, preventing extreme temperature modifications, and prompt repairs for any new damage can help maintain window stability and extend their life expectancy.
